Skin lightening treatments in Canada typically involve the use of topical creams, serums, or oral supplements that contain active ingredients like hydroquinone, vitamin C, or kojic acid. These products work by inhibiting the production of melanin, the pigment responsible for skin color. The healing time for these types of treatments can range from a few weeks to a few months, depending on the individual's skin type, the strength of the product, and the consistency of use.
For more intensive skin lightening procedures, such as chemical peels or laser treatments, the healing time can be slightly longer. Chemical peels, which remove the top layer of skin to reveal a lighter, more even complexion, typically require a recovery period of 7-14 days. During this time, the skin may be red, sensitive, and prone to peeling. Laser treatments, which target specific areas of hyperpigmentation, may require a healing time of 10-21 days, depending on the intensity of the treatment.
It's important to note that the healing process can be influenced by various factors, including the individual's skin type, age, and overall health. Individuals with sensitive skin or a history of skin conditions may experience a longer healing time or may be more prone to side effects, such as redness, irritation, or post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ation.
To ensure a smooth and safe healing process, it is crucial to follow the instructions provided by the healthcare professional and to attend all follow-up appointments. Proper aftercare, such as using gentle cleansers, applying sunscreen, and avoiding direct sun exposure, can also help to minimize the risk of complications and optimize the results of the skin lightening treatment.
